Summary:
"Come along on a math adventure to discover how to measure shapes, how to solve equations, and so much more! This fun question and answer book has everything from facts and figures to simple diagrams and hilarious illustrations to help you learn introductory geometry terms and concepts, including radius, diameter, area, volume, and more." -- Back cover.
